In the cases where Automatic Recovery is supported (as noted in Table 76 ), the WM8321 will re-start
the WM8321 following the Reset, and return the device to the ON state. The particular Reset
condition which caused the return to the ON state will be indicated in the “ON Source” register - see
Section 11.3.
Note that, if a Watchdog timeout or Converter undervoltage fault persists, a maximum of 6 Device
Resets will be attempted to initiate the start-up sequence. Similarly, a maximum of 6 Software Resets
is permitted. If these limits are exceeded, the WM8321 will remain in the OFF state until the next valid
ON state transition event occurs.
The WM8321 asserts the RESET
¯¯¯¯¯¯ low as soon as the device begins the shutdown sequence. RESET
¯¯¯¯¯¯
is held low for the duration of the shutdown sequence and is held low in the OFF state. In the cases
where Automatic Recovery is supported, RESET
¯¯¯¯¯¯ is automatically cleared (high) after successful
completion of the startup sequence. The duration of the RESET
¯¯¯¯¯¯ low period after the startup sequence
has completed is governed by the RST_DUR register field described in Section 11.7.
